As any fan of various role-playing games knows, at the core of great RPGs is their ability to force choices on the player. No matter how substantial or inconsequential these choices are, forcing the player to make a decision makes their whole experience with the game that much more personal. Mass Effect Legendary Edition is no different, featuring many different choices all the way to each game’s finale. During the finale of the first title, you’re forced to make a difficult choice about the council. If you’re conflicted as to the effects this has on the rest of the series though, no need to worry. In this guide, we’ll explain whether you should save or sacrifice the council in Mass Effect Legendary Edition!

Save or Sacrifice the Council in Mass Effect Legendary Edition

Mass Effect Legendary Edition Save the Council

For starters, choosing to save the council will result in the most paragon points for your Shepard and will ultimately have the best impact on your future ventures. You won’t see much as far as the fruits of your labor, as the council will still act condescending towards Shepard, but you’ll also have the Destiny Ascension War Asset for the end of the third title. On the other hand though, if you go the renegade option and choose to sacrifice the council, this will have fairly large consequences on the future games. The other races will hold negative feelings towards the human race for one, holding issue with their choice to forget others for the sake of their own skin. Not to mention the Destiny Ascension War Asset won’t be available and will skip out on a short cutscene during Mass Effect 3’s final battle.

All in all, you’ll have a slightly easier time if you choose to save the council in the very end. The galaxy will hate you less, and every little bit helps when it comes to tackling the Reaper threat.
